I was tasked to clone a user role for a site the other day. Here are the options one has:
- Execute a db query -> not user-friendly
- Create a new role, then manually set the same permissions as another role -> endless scrolling and clicking on checkboxes ; becomes worse the more contrib with additional permissions a site has (or many content types, since they also add multiple permissions); becomes even worse if the role you want to clone has many permissions assigned to it (might also become a victim of https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/1203766 if the site has many roles)
- https://www.drupal.org/project/duplicate_role (have not actually tested it) -> not ported to Backdrop
We should have a "Clone role" action.
